I don't believe the picture you provided is where the slide happened. The slide happened between Mosquito and Miner's beach, and did not impact any trail in that area. This photo looks to be between Chapel Beach and Mosquito beach area, to the west of Grand Portal. Slides happen all the time at PIRO - large chunks about once every 1 to 2 years. Over this past winter a large chunk near the dunes fell off eliminating about 100 ft of trail. Tip: if you start hearing or seeing small rocks falling time to get away from the edge!
